Subject: Handover — webhook delivery retries

Hi Renske,

Taking over from me on the Dovetail delivery service: retries use exponential backoff, capped at six attempts over 24 hours. Failures land in the dead-letter table; anything older than a week gets archived by the Sunday job. Don't re-enqueue dead letters manually without resetting the attempt counter. The delivery-state database is reachable with the connection string below.

Thanks,
Joram

replica DSN, yahaf-yagaf: mongodb://tamath_svc:a2netSk3RZMuTj@db-d084.novacsoft.internal:5432/ralmir

### FareSplit Pricing Experiment — On-Call Notes

The FareSplit experiment adjusts ticket prices for the Dunmore venue cohort every hour. If allocation drifts past 5%, pause the assigner job and page the experiments channel. Assignment logs live in the experiments store; the assigner connects to it with the connection string below.

replica DSN, kajep-yahag: mssql://praok_svc:iF@db-8d68.plorvaio.local:5432/eliion

## Releases

Paperline renders PDF invoices for all Brockhaven tenants. Support team: do not hotfix templates in production. Releases cut every Tuesday from main; tags follow `pl-vX.Y.Z`. If a customer reports rendering drift, check the release notes first — font bundle changes are the usual cause. Rollbacks are one command via the deploy script; escalate to the Paperline on-call if fonts fail to embed. All release artifacts must be verified before deploy using the signing key below.

signing key of baduf-taweg = bky6_Zf7bem